Kimberly is a village located in Outagamie County, Wisconsin. Kimberly has a 2025 population of 7,824. Kimberly is currently growing at a rate of 1.28% annually and its population has increased by 6.77%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 7,328 in 2020.
The average household income in Kimberly is $83,500 with a poverty rate of 9.62%. The median age in Kimberly is 41 years: 38.2 years for males, and 43.1 years for females.
